,如果选中的是add checked libraries to project build-path,他的包只是引用如果要移植程序的话就会报错

解决方案 »

  1.   

    Add checked Libraries to project build-path:它只会把build-path中引入的包指向myeclipse中lib的位置,也就是把myeclipse中你需要的lib作为外部(exterial)包导入, 而没有拷贝到你的项目的lib目录.
    Copy checked Libraries contents to project folder: 将会把需要的lib拷贝到你的项目的lib目录并且加入到build-path.你可以分别按这两种方式作一下,然后查看项目属性, 看build-path,你会看到你刚才加入的lib的存储地址.说实话我不建议这种方式. myeclipse自动添加的lib有的你根本都不用到. 你根本就不知道它有什么用.你自己从头到尾自己搭建一个框架, 手动写配置文件, 如果缺失了包会报错, 就这样一步一步的调试, 直到搭建成功. 这样搞清楚以后你以后用myeclipse也知道它给你作了什么.